Vegetable Glycerin
Vegetable glycerine is derived from fat and oil sources, typically coconut or palm oils through hydrolysis. Vegetable Glycerine is a clear, colorless, and odorless liquid with an incredibly sweet taste having the consistency of thick syrup. It is used as an agent in cosmetics, toothpaste, shampoos, soaps, herbal remedies, pharmaceuticals, and other household items. Vegetable glycerine has emollient-like properties, it can soften and soothe the skin and it assists the outer epidermis is retaining moisture. Vegetable glycerine is soluble in both water and alcohol.
